It's a simple fact that an NHL organization cannot keep everyone forever. Whether it's players, scouts or management teams are always looking for quality candidates who would replace others and make the organization stronger.

The Flyers coaching staff has produced a surprisingly great season considering where most people thought the team would be going into October. Jamey Baskow tweeded that he feels one of the Flyers coaches will become a head coach next year.
Shaw, has a strong history with hockey as he was a player drafted by the 1982 Detroit Red Wings in which his career spanned from 1984 though 1999. After he retired, he worked with numerous organisations including the New York Islanders, St Louis Blues the Vancouver Canucks and the Flyers.
Given the trend of NHL coaches becoming younger and organizations hiring assistants, it's highly likely this man will become a head coach in the very near future. It's also a good sign that the organization he's coming from is producing good people which means a strong program.
